about summary refs log tree commit diff
path: root/src/libutil/serialise.cc
AgeCommit message (Expand)AuthorFilesLines
2019-03-14 experimental/optional -> optionalEelco Dolstra1-1/+1
2018-09-26 sinkToSource(): Start the coroutine lazilyEelco Dolstra1-11/+15
2018-09-26 Make NAR header check more robustEelco Dolstra1-2/+3
2018-08-21 Improve 'coroutine has finished' error messageEelco Dolstra1-6/+9
2018-07-31 Add a check for broken Boost versionsEelco Dolstra1-0/+4
2018-05-21 serialise: fix buffer size used, hide method for internal use onlyWill Dietz1-1/+1
2018-03-19 serialise.cc: remove pessimising moveWill Dietz1-1/+1
2018-03-16 Reduce substitution memory consumptionEelco Dolstra1-0/+63
2018-02-13 Fix #1762Linus Heckemann1-1/+2
2017-03-01 readString(): Read directly into std::stringEelco Dolstra1-3/+3
2017-03-01 Handle importing NARs containing files greater than 4 GiBEelco Dolstra1-40/+3
2017-01-16 AutoDeleteArray -> std::unique_ptrEelco Dolstra1-4/+4
2016-09-21 printMsg(lvlError, ...) -> printError(...) etc.Eelco Dolstra1-1/+1
2016-07-13 Make Buffered{Source,Sink} move-safeShea Levy1-21/+6
2016-03-04 Eliminate some large string copyingEelco Dolstra1-2/+2
2016-02-26 FdSource: track number of bytes readEelco Dolstra1-1/+2
2016-02-24 Remove bad daemon connections from the poolEelco Dolstra1-3/+19
2015-09-03 Implement buildDerivation() via the daemonEelco Dolstra1-0/+7
2015-07-20 More cleanupEelco Dolstra1-56/+15
2015-07-17 OCD: foreach -> C++11 ranged forEelco Dolstra1-2/+2
2015-07-17 Allow remote builds without sending the derivation closureEelco Dolstra1-1/+31
2014-06-10 Print a warning when loading a large path into memoryEelco Dolstra1-0/+27
2014-03-12 Remove unnecessary null pointer checksEelco Dolstra1-2/+2
2013-06-07 Process stderr from substituters while doing have/info queriesEelco Dolstra1-0/+6
2012-02-09 Use data() instead of c_str() where appropriateEelco Dolstra1-1/+1
2011-12-16 * importPath() -> importPaths(). Because of buffering of the inputEelco Dolstra1-5/+11
2011-12-16 * Avoid expensive conversions from char arrays to STL strings.Eelco Dolstra1-3/+18
2011-12-16 * Make the import operation through the daemon much more efficientEelco Dolstra1-12/+30
2011-12-16 * Clean up exception handling.Eelco Dolstra1-2/+9
2011-12-15 * Refactoring: move sink/source buffering into separate classes.Eelco Dolstra1-23/+46
2011-12-15 * Buffer reads in FdSource. Together with write buffering, thisEelco Dolstra1-1/+23
2011-12-14 * Buffer writes in FdSink. This significantly reduces the number ofEelco Dolstra1-1/+24
2009-03-22 * NAR archives: handle files larger than 2^32 bytes. Previously itEelco Dolstra1-2/+2
2008-06-18 * Some refactoring: put the GC options / results in separate structs.Eelco Dolstra1-0/+31
2008-05-21 * GCC 4.3.0 (Fedora 9) compatibility fixes. Reported by Gour andEelco Dolstra1-0/+2
2006-12-04 * Daemon mode (`nix-worker --daemon'). Clients connect to the serverEelco Dolstra1-3/+4
2006-11-30 * More remote operations.Eelco Dolstra1-0/+18
2006-11-30 * Skeleton of the privileged worker program.Eelco Dolstra1-0/+87